Monday, August 21, 2006

France Country road locks and castles

France the country that took the Vines and winemaking from the Greeks and made it " their own" the children loved the old looks and the nice country look they liked some of the camping spots and you will see some in othere videos but some of the country roads were not " made for a Lada ".
Post a Comment